Don’t be a Jerk Policy

 

This “Don’t be a jerk” policy is a shortened, more casual version of the longer Code of Conduct policy. Read full version.

GDG Thessaloniki pride on being open, respectful, and an inclusive community. That means jerky behavior isn’t allowed at GDG meetings or events. Because we know that it’s not obvious to everyone, here’s a reminder of the things we don’t allow: jokes or offensive comments about sex/sexuality/race/religion/nationality/body size, showing porn in public, touching people uninvited, or continuing to interact with someone after they’ve asked you to stop. Continuous jerky behavior may result in getting expelled from the meeting or GDG Chapter.

If someone is bothering you, please tell GDG Organizers immediately and they will take care of it. We want to maintain GDG DevFest’s awesomeness.
